For the 2026 school year, there are 7 public charter schools serving 5,220 students in Van Nuys, CA.
The top-ranked public charter schools in Van Nuys, CA are High Tech La, Champs - Charter High School Of Arts-multimedia & Performing and Birmingham Community Charter High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Van Nuys, CA public charter schools have an average math proficiency score of 25% (versus the California public charter school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 48% statewide average). Charter schools in Van Nuys have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of California public charter schools.
Minority enrollment is 84%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public charter school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
